Healthcare Innovation and Telemedicine: The Rise of Telehealth Platforms and Remote Patient Monitoring

 Telemedicine has transformed the healthcare scene, providing seamless access to medical services regardless of geography. Telehealth platforms and remote patient monitoring (RPM) systems have emerged as transformative forces in modern medicine, driven by rapid technological improvements and increased demand for remote care.


The Evolution of Telemedicine and Its Role in Modern Healthcare

Telemedicine started as a way to provide healthcare services to rural and underprivileged areas. It eventually became a vital part of the worldwide healthcare system. Telemedicine allows for virtual consultations, diagnostic evaluations, and even specialized care via digital platforms.

The COVID-19 pandemic has pushed the use of telemedicine as patients and doctors seek safe, efficient alternatives to in-person encounters. This paradigm shift highlighted telemedicine's ability to reduce the burden on traditional healthcare systems, increase accessibility, and improve patient outcomes.


Telehealth Platforms: Bridging the Gap Between Patients and Providers



Telehealth platforms are the foundation of modern telemedicine, enabling real-time interactions between patients and healthcare professionals. These platforms provide a wide range of services, including virtual consultations, prescription administration, and follow-up care.

The Importance of Remote Patient Monitoring

Remote patient monitoring uses connected equipment to track a patient's health indicators in real time. RPM systems collect important data from wearable devices and smartphone apps, allowing healthcare doctors to make informed decisions without the need for an in-person visit.

How RPM Enhances Patient Care.
1. Continuous Monitoring- Devices monitor vital signs such as heart rate, blood pressure, and glucose levels around the clock.
2. Proactive Interventions- Alerts for aberrant readings allow for early intervention and avoid problems.
3. Chronic Disease Management- Patients with diabetes, hypertension, or respiratory diseases benefit greatly from regular monitoring.
4. Reduced hospital readmissions- RPM promotes health stability and reduces the need for emergency care.


Advancements Driving Telemedicine and RPM Adoption



Recent technological advancements have made telemedicine and RPM more efficient and accessible than before. Let's look at the key developments driving this transformation:

1. AI and Machine Learning in Telehealth
Predictive analytics, individualized treatment plans, and automated administrative activities are all powered by artificial intelligence. This minimizes the workload of clinicians while increasing diagnostic accuracy.

2. 5G connectivity
The deployment of 5G networks provides flawless video consultations and fast data transfer, even in faraway locations. This technical leap improves the user experience and broadens access to telehealth services.

3. Wearable devices
Wearables, which range from smartwatches to specialized medical gadgets, provide people control over their health. ECG monitors and fitness trackers capture precise data, which is then sent into RPM systems for further analysis.

4. Interoperability Standards
Standardized data-sharing standards ensure that information from different telehealth platforms and devices is compatible, which increases efficiency and patient care coordination.

Challenges in Telemedicine and Remote Monitoring

Despite its benefits, telemedicine confronts a number of hurdles that must be overcome in order for it to become widely adopted.

1. Regulation and Licensing Issues
Different state and country restrictions might make it difficult to deliver telehealth services, especially for cross-border consultations.

2. Data Privacy and Security
Because telemedicine relies primarily on digital platforms, protecting sensitive patient data is critical. Cybersecurity measures must keep up with developing threats.

3. Technological Access Disparities
Not all patients have dependable internet or access to current gadgets, which limits telemedicine's accessibility in underprivileged places.
